Role Overview The Aircraft Maintenance Technician (AMT) is responsible for performing maintenance, preventative maintenance and alterations of Breeze aircraft, including troubleshooting, performing run-up and taxi procedures and signing mechanical flight releases. The AMT reports to a Line Maintenance Supervisor and carries out instructions as assigned in accordance with FAA regulations and Breeze policy and procedures. As certified AMTs, postholders have an important role in ensuring the safety of fellow Breeze Team Members and Guests as well as the airworthiness of the fleet. Physical Demands & Working Conditions Frequently lift, carry, push or pull items up to 50 lbs, and occasionally up to 75 lbs with assistance as needed. Climb ladders, work stands and aircraft structures, and work at elevated heights. Work in confined spaces, awkward positions and varying weather conditions on the ramp or in the hangar. Regularly stand, walk, bend, kneel, crouch, crawl and reach for extended periods. Frequent use of hands and arms to operate tools and handle components, requiring manual dexterity. Adequate vision to inspect closely and hearing to detect unusual sounds; exposure to noise and fumes. Salary Pay is based on years of experience: year 1 - $30.50 per hour; year 2 - $31.00; year 3 - $31.50; year 4 - $34.50; year 5 - $36.00; year 6 - $37.00. A $2.00 shift differential is added when working from 9:00 PM to 7:30 AM. What We Offer Health, vision and dental cover for full-time employees.
